How to chech table growth in SAP

hi
i have a ECC6 on AIX plateform and database is oracle 10 i want to know how can i check which table is grow faster and what action i will take for smooth running of SAP system?
Thanks
Vikram

Hi Vikram
Goto DB02 and then click on Space Statistic. For tables/indexes and tablespace give * and it will give you the table/tablespace statistics. You can select days, weeks and month wise.
For extending tablespace user brtools from ora<sid>.

  • Sap script '' how to create table frame in sap script"""

    i have some problem in sap script''  how to create table frame in sap script"""

    Hi,
    you can use BOX command..
    Syntax
    /: BOX [XPOS] [YPOS] [WIDTH] [HEIGHT] [FRAME] [INTENSITY]
    Effect: draws a box of the specified size at the specified position.
    Parameters: For each of XPOS, YPOS, WIDTH, HEIGHT and FRAME both a measurement and a unit of measurement must be specified. The INTENSITY parameter should be specified as a percentage between 0 and 100.
    1. XPOS, YPOS: Upper left corner of the box, relative to the values of the POSITION command.
    Default: Values specified in the POSITION command.
    The following calculation is performed internally to determine the absolute output position of a box on the page:
    X(abs) = XORIGIN + XPOS
    Y(abs) = YORIGIN + YPOS
    2. WIDTH: Width of the box. Default: WIDTH value of the SIZE command.
    3. HEIGHT: Height of the box. Default: HEIGHT value of the SIZE command.
    4. FRAME: Thickness of frame.
    Default: 0 (no frame).
    5. INTENSITY: Grayscale of box contents as % .
    Default: 100 (full black)
    Measurements: Decimal numbers must be specified as literal values (like ABAP numeric constants) by being enclosed in inverted commas. The period should be used as the decimal point character. See also the examples listed below.
    Units of measurement: The following units of measurement may be used:
    • TW (twip)
    • PT (point)
    • IN (inch)
    • MM (millimeter)
    • CM (centimeter)
    • LN (line)
    • CH (character).
    The following conversion factors apply:
    • 1 TW = 1/20 PT
    • 1 PT = 1/72 IN
    • 1 IN = 2.54 CM
    • 1 CM = 10 MM
    • 1 CH = height of a character relative to the CPI specification in the layout set header
    • 1 LN = height of a line relative to the LPI specification in the layout set header
    /: BOX FRAME 10 TW
    Draws a frame around the current window with a frame thickness of 10 TW (= 0.5 PT).
    /: BOX INTENSITY 10
    Fills the window background with shadowing having a gray scale of 10 %.
    /: BOX HEIGHT 0 TW FRAME 10 TW
    Draws a horizontal line across the complete top edge of the window.
    /: BOX WIDTH 0 TW FRAME 10 TW
    Draws a vertical line along the complete height of the left hand edge of the window.
    /: BOX WIDTH '17.5' CM HEIGHT 1 CM FRAME 10 TW INTENSITY 15
    /: BOX WIDTH '17.5' CM HEIGHT '13.5' CM FRAME 10 TW
    /: BOX XPOS '10.0' CM WIDTH 0 TW HEIGHT '13.5' CM FRAME 10 TW
    /: BOX XPOS '13.5' CM WIDTH 0 TW HEIGHT '13.5' CM FRAME 10 TW
    Draws two rectangles and two lines to construct a table of three columns with a highlighted heading section.

  • How are attribute and text master data tables linked in SAP R/3?

    Hello,
    how are attribute and text master data tables linked in SAP R/3?
    Most tables with attribute master data like T001 for company codes,
    have a text master data table T001T (add "T" to table name).
    When looking at the content of table T001 via transaction se11,
    the text are automatically joined.
    But for some tables there is no "T"-table (e.g. table TVBUR for sales offices
    has no text table TVBURT), but in se11 you get texts. There is an address
    link in TVBUR, but the Name1, etc. are empty.
    a) Where are the text stored?
    b) How does the system know of the link?
    Hope someone can help!
    Best regards
    Thomas

    Hi Thomas
    The master and text table are not linked by name, of course, if you see the text table, it has the same key fields of master table, only it has the field key spras and the field for description.
    The link beetween the tables is done by foreign key: if you check the text table TVKBT u need to see how the foreign key for field VKBUR is done:
    -> Foreing key with table TVBUR
    -> Foreing key field type -> KEY FIELD FOR A TEXT TABLE
    ->Cardinality-> 1-:CN
    It's very important the attribute sets for Foreing key field type, if it's KEY FIELD FOR A TEXT TABLE, it'll mean the table is a text table: i.e. that mean the master table is a check table for the text table, where the foreign key type is for text table.
    U can find out the text table of master table by SE11: GoTo->Text Table
    U can fined some information in table DD08L.

    Sudhakar,
    There are tables you can archive / clean up and then there are tables you cannot do anything about. For example - if your system has a million queries - the RSRREPDIR , RZCOMPDIR tables will be large.
    The tables that typically get archived are :
    1. BALDAT / BALHDR - application log tables
    2. Monitor tables - search for Request archiving which will tell you how to archive the same
    The other tables -
    First you would have to understand why they are large in the first place ... if you have too many hierarchies - then some tables can be huge - delete some of the hierarchies you do not need and the table sizes should come down.
    RSRWBSTORE - this is the internal store for workbooks - this will have the last executed version of the workbook stored in the table. This information is called when the workbook is executed without refreshing the variables - which is why you get the workbook output first and then get prompted to refresh the variables.

  • SAP QUERY(SQ03/02/02) - how to join tables

    Hi MM Wizards,
    I would like to know how to join tables EINE & A017 through SAP Query?
    Thanks,
    Kaveri

    Hi Kaveri,
    A017 is a pooled table.  SAP Query does not support joins against Pooled tables.  You should stick to transparent tables if you want to use Query.
    You can do a direct read of A017, but you will just end up with a glorified SE16 display.
    You could have a programmer write some ABAP and place it into the 'extras' section in SQ02 to grab the additional data that you want, but once you have decided to enlist the aid of an ABAPer, it is better just to write a custom Z program from scratch.

  • How to  access the ORACLE APPS table structures from SAP

    Hi Experts,
        How to  access the ORACLE APPS table structures from SAP? Is it possible from SAP?
    Thanks in advance
    Thomas

    Hi Silviya,
    you can access this database using a technique called DB Multiconnect - sometimes written as multi-connect.
    Search the SAP documentation and notes for this term and you will find how to do it.
    Essentially you configure the remote database connection via transaction DBCON.
    If your SAP system is not running on Oracle you will need to install the db-specific kernel files for Oracle along with the Oracel db client software - SQL*Net.
    Then you can access the Oracle database from ABAP using native-SQL. It works a treat!

    The question is, what is a "very fast growth rate"?
    What are the DDL of the table resp. the data types that the table uses?
    One potential issue could be the way the table is populated: If you constantly insert into the table using a direct-path insert (APPEND hint) and subsequently delete rows then your table will grow faster than required because the deleted rows won't be reused by the direct-path insert because it always writes above the current high-water mark of your table.
    May be you want to check your application for such an case if you think that the table grows faster than the actual amount of data it contains.
    You could use the ANALYZE command to get information about empty blocks and average free space in the blocks or use the procedures provided by DBMS_SPACE package to find out more about the current usage of your segment.
